Gwen Ramokgopha, Tshwane executive mayor, will set up a 2010 Project Office as part of the town's preparations for the World Cup.

It will deal specifically with matters relating to the 2010 World Cup on behalf of the Tshwane Metropolitan Municipality. The 2010 Project Office is expected to be operational in two months' time. Ramokgopha said everything has been put in place to ensure that the municipality stages successful World Cup matches.

She said they will be appointing engineers to start with the upgrading of Loftus Stadium, one of the venues selected for the World Cup. - Ramatsiyi Moholoa
